Angela Autumn Confronts Vices and Roots on Her Evocative New Single “Heavy Tobacco”
If you keep your ear to the ground for genuine songwriting, you already know Angela Autumn. Based out of Nashville, this sharp-witted songwriter and banjo player doesn’t make music that neatly fits into a genre box. Instead, she takes the dark, complicated stories of her Allegheny childhood and reinvents folk tradition through a lens that feels deeply human, earthy, and refreshingly unpretentious.
Her latest release, “Heavy Tobacco” is a masterclass in modern roots music—one that proves why she is one of the most compelling voices speaking from the fringes of the genre today.
The Meaning Behind “Heavy Tobacco”
On the surface, “Heavy Tobacco” zeroes in on the familiar habits and vices that linger in our lives. But Autumn has never been an artist who deals in surface-level storytelling.
As she describes it, the track is a meditation on the tobacco spirit—acknowledging how something once held sacred for its purification properties can slowly turn harmful when abused. It’s a clever, gritty metaphor for how we chase fleeting ambitions, lose track of time, and grapple with the heavy footprint we leave on the world around us.
There’s an outsider’s honesty in the way she delivers these lines. Her voice doesn’t hide behind slick production tricks; it sounds like someone sitting right across from you, telling it straight.
A Sonic Shift That Defies Tradition
While Autumn’s clawhammer banjo playing is a massive part of her signature sound, “Heavy Tobacco” isn’t some dusty museum piece. She takes traditional instrumentation and drags it right into the modern grit of alternative country and roots rock.
The track moves with a raw, off-kilter energy, driven by arrangements that feel alive and unpredictable. It captures the sounds of the unspoken—those quiet realizations you only come to terms with when you finally slow down and look at where you came from.
